About Chacheri

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Chacheri village is 077027. Chacheri village is located in Sapotra tehsil of Karauli district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Sapotra (tehsildar office) and 82km away from district headquarter Karauli. As per 2009 stats, Maharajpura is the gram panchayat of Chacheri village.

The total geographical area of village is 1212.42 hectares. Chacheri has a total population of 474 peoples, out of which male population is 281 while female population is 193. Literacy rate of chacheri village is 51.27% out of which 61.92% males and 35.75% females are literate. There are about 128 houses in chacheri village. Pincode of chacheri village locality is 322243.

Karauli is nearest town to chacheri for all major economic activities, which is approximately 82km away.
